BTLE tracking requires root privileges.
|
||||
|
||||
For running Home Assistant as non root user we can give python3 the missing capabilities to access the bluetooth stack. Quite like setting the setuid bit (see [Stack Exchange](http://unix.stackexchange.com/questions/96106/bluetooth-le-scan-as-non-root) for more information).
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
sudo apt-get install libcap2-bin
|
||||
sudo setcap 'cap_net_raw,cap_net_admin+eip' `readlink -f \`which python3\``
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
A restart of Home Assistant is required.
